Output 7ab5e52d04cf788650950696ea22fcc0a96d6fadd7c7bfd203a0cb10ba408921:4

value
21977796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ae418e5cc8f8fc0ca6087cd0c0c3adacc9240586 OP_EQUAL
address
3HaQ2qgYEgdgLyLu1kvTf25JX5Bwb2ywZf
transaction
7ab5e52d04cf788650950696ea22fcc0a96d6fadd7c7bfd203a0cb10ba408921
spent
true